Comparison review

Galaxy Tab S4 is much better than Asus ZenPad 10, having a 78.8 score against 63.6. The Galaxy Tab S4 design is newer, just a little bit lighter and somewhat thinner than Asus ZenPad 10. The Galaxy Tab S4 counts with a better performance than Asus ZenPad 10, because it has a larger amount of RAM and a higher number of cores.

The Galaxy Tab S4 has a sharper display than Asus ZenPad 10, because it has a little larger screen, more pixels per inch of screen and a higher resolution of 1600 x 2560 pixels. The Galaxy Tab S4 shoots way better photos and videos than Asus ZenPad 10, because it has a lot higher resolution back facing camera.

The Galaxy Tab S4 features a bigger storage capacity to install games and applications than Asus ZenPad 10, and although they both have equal internal storage, the Galaxy Tab S4 also has an external memory card slot that admits a maximum of 400 GB. The Galaxy Tab S4 features a way better battery duration than Asus ZenPad 10, because it has a 56 percent larger battery size.
